IP List distribution The Man Who Fell to Earth 1 - LostFilm.TV, total 3
IP Country City ISP
5.2.53.55 Russia Serov UGMK-Telecom LLC
89.23.206.7 Russia Klimovsk Klimovsk network Ltd
94.19.143.236 Russia Saint Petersburg Skynet Ltd